Ingredients You’ll Need

To make this delightful Chocolate Cream Cold Brew, gather the following ingredients:

  • 1 cup cold brew coffee: The star of our drink, cold brew offers a smooth, less acidic coffee flavor.
  • ¾ cup ice cubes: To chill your drink to perfection.
  • 3 tablespoons heavy cream: This adds richness and creaminess to the chocolate cream.
  • 1 tablespoon milk: For an added silkiness to the cream.
  • 1 tablespoon chocolate syrup: Infuses the drink with a sweet, chocolatey flavor.
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ract: Enhances the overall flavor profile with a hint of warmth.
  • 1 teaspoon sugar (optional): Sweeten to taste if you prefer a sweeter drink.

How to Make Chocolate Cream Cold Brew

Ready to embark on your chocolate cold brew adventure? Follow these simple steps:

  1. In a small bowl, combine 3 tablespoons heavy cream, 1 tablespoon milk, 1 tablespoon chocolate syrup, ½ teaspoon vanilla extract, and 1 teaspoon sugar (optional). Whisk for about 20-30 seconds until the mixture thickens slightly and becomes smooth and creamy.
  2. Take a tall serving glass and add ¾ cup ice cubes, filling the glass almost to the top.
  3. Slowly pour in 1 cup cold brew coffee over the ice, leaving about ½ inch of space at the top for the chocolate cream.
  4. Gently pour the whisked chocolate cream mixture over the top of the cold brew. Enjoy your beautifully layered drink!

Pro Tips for the Perfect Cold Brew

Side angle of a refreshing Chocolate Cream Cold Brew filled with ice and topped with whipped cream and chocolate sauce.
  • Choosing Coffee: Use high-quality coffee beans for the best flavor. Medium or dark roast works beautifully in cold brew.
  • Brewing Time: For a smoother taste, let your cold brew steep for at least 12-24 hours in the fridge.
  • Make Ahead: Prepare the chocolate cream mixture in advance and store it in the fridge for up to 3 days.
  • Ice Cubes: For a stronger coffee flavor, freeze some leftover cold brew into ice cubes to avoid diluting your drink.
  • Experiment with Flavors: Try adding different flavored syrups or a sprinkle of cinnamon for a unique twist.
  • Serving Temperature: Serve immediately after preparing to enjoy the fresh flavors and textures.
  • Presentation: Garnish with whipped cream or a drizzle of chocolate syrup for an extra touch of indulgence.
  • Mind the Ratio: Adjust the amount of cream and syrup based on your sweetness preference.

Common Mistakes and Troubleshooting

Even the best of us can stumble in the kitchen! Here are some common pitfalls and how to avoid them:

  • Overmixing the Cream: Whisk just until combined to avoid making butter instead of cream.
  • Using Too Much Ice: This can water down your drink. Measure the ice to ensure a balanced flavor.
  • Not Steeping Long Enough: If your cold brew is too weak, let it steep longer next time for a bolder flavor.
  • Skipping Ingredients: Each ingredient plays a crucial role in achieving the perfect balance. Don’t leave out the vanilla extract or sugar unless you prefer a less sweet drink.

Variations to Try

Feeling adventurous? Here are some fun twists on the classic Chocolate Cream Cold Brew:

  • Mint Chocolate Cold Brew: Add a few drops of peppermint extract to the chocolate cream for a refreshing minty flavor.
  • Mocha Cold Brew: Stir in 1 tablespoon of cocoa powder to the cold brew for an intense chocolate hit.
  • Spiced Chocolate Cold Brew: Add a pinch of cayenne pepper or nutmeg for a warm, spicy kick.
  • Dairy-Free Version: Substitute heavy cream with coconut cream and milk with almond or oat milk for a vegan-friendly treat.

Storage and Make-Ahead Instructions

Planning to enjoy this drink over multiple days? Here’s how to store and prepare ahead:

  • Cold Brew Coffee: Store the brewed coffee in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 weeks.
  • Chocolate Cream: Make the cream mixture in advance and keep it in the fridge for up to 3 days. Just give it a quick whisk before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ions

Let’s address some common questions about Chocolate Cream Cold Brew:

  • Can I use regular coffee instead of cold brew? Yes, but cold brew offers a smoother taste that’s less acidic.
  • How can I sweeten my cold brew? You can add sugar, flavored syrups, or even honey to taste.
  • What’s the best way to brew cold brew at home? Combine coarsely ground coffee with cold water and steep for 12-24 hours, then strain.
  • How do I make this drink less sweet? Reduce the amount of chocolate syrup or sugar in the cream mixture.
  • Can I make this drink vegan? Absolutely! Substitute dairy with plant-based alternatives like almond milk and coconut cream.
  • What should I do if my cold brew is too strong? Dilute it with water or milk to reach your preferred strength.
  • How long does the chocolate cream last? The chocolate cream can be stored in the fridge for up to 3 days.
  • Can I freeze the chocolate cream? It’s best enjoyed fresh, but you can freeze it in ice cube trays for later use!
